Summary

Rachel Lindsay and Callie Curry kick off today’s Morally Corrupt by discussing the recent news that Jen Shah will be released from prison next year and what life after release might look like for her (2:53). Afterward, they move on to debate whether Kyle’s texts with PK were out of line on Season 14, Episode 7 of The Real Housewives of Beverly Hills (8:35). Then, Rachel is joined by Jodi Walker to discuss the dinner party from hell featured on the Season 5 finale of The Real Housewives of Salt Lake City (28:38), as well as Ubah’s Puerto Rico freak-out on Season 15, Episode 14 of The Real Housewives of New York (59:18).
